First, understand your digestive health needs. Assess whether you are experiencing bloating, gas, constipation, or other digestive issues. Different supplements target different aspects of gut health. Probiotics, for example, are beneficial for promoting the growth of healthy bacteria in your gut. If your goal is to balance your gut microbiome, consider a probiotic supplement. On the other hand, if you are looking to ease symptoms like gas and bloating, digestive enzymes might be the right choice, as they help break down food more effectively.
Second, scrutinize the ingredient list. A quality digestive support supplement should have a transparent and straightforward ingredient list, avoiding unnecessary fillers and additives. Look for high-quality, natural ingredients such as prebiotics, probiotics, enzymes, and herbs known for their digestive benefits. Common probiotics include strains like Lactobacillus and Bifidobacterium, which have been studied extensively for their positive effects on gut health.
Next, consider the dosage and potency of the supplement. It’s essential to choose a product that provides effective dosages. For probiotics, look for products that contain a variety of strains and a high number of colony-forming units (CFUs). A count of at least 1 billion CFUs per serving is often recommended, but some formulations could contain significantly more, which may yield better results. Be sure to follow the manufacturer’s recommended dosage instructions while also consulting with your healthcare provider, especially if you are taking other medications or have underlying health conditions.
Manufacturer reputation plays a significant role in the selection process. Choose brands that are well-established and have a solid reputation for quality and safety. Look for supplements that are third-party tested for purity and potency. This ensures that what is on the label is accurately represented in the product and free from harmful contaminants. Reviews and testimonials from other users can also provide insights into the effectiveness and trustworthiness of the supplement.
Additionally, consider any dietary restrictions you may have. Some digestive support supplements may contain allergens or ingredients that do not align with specific dietary practices, such as gluten, dairy, or soy. Look for products that are certified allergen-free if you have sensitivities. Vegetarians and vegans should also seek plant-based formulations that do not include animal-derived ingredients.
Timing and consistency are also important factors to note. Some supplements are best taken with meals, while others might be more effective on an empty stomach. Understanding the right time to take your supplement will maximize its benefits. Moreover, consistency is key. Many digestive supplements can take a few days to weeks to show noticeable effects, so sticking to a regular regimen is essential for long-term results.
Finally, don’t hesitate to consult with healthcare professionals, such as dietitians or nutritionists, who can provide personalized recommendations based on your individual health needs. They can help you navigate through various options, ensuring you choose the supplement that best fits your digestive health goals.
